Water Elimination Strategies
Reliable water removal is critical in mitigating damages and stopping further problems such as mold and mildew growth. The initial step in this procedure entails identifying the resource of water breach, which might be from flooding, leaks, or other factors. As soon as the resource is attended to, different methods can be employed for reliable water elimination.
One typical method is making use of completely submersible pumps, which are suitable for eliminating standing water in bigger locations. These pumps can efficiently extract substantial volumes of water rapidly. For smaller sized, a lot more confined rooms, wet/dry vacuum cleaners are typically utilized to take care of recurring moisture properly.

Protecting Against Future Problems
Home owners' watchfulness is important in avoiding future water damage problems. Regular maintenance of plumbing systems is essential; this includes monitoring for leakages, rust, and making sure that seals around sinks, bathrooms, and tubs remain intact. In addition, evaluating roof covering seamless gutters and downspouts consistently can protect against water from merging near the foundation, which may bring about substantial water invasion.
Proper landscape design is an additional important element. Guarantee that the ground inclines far from your home's foundation to facilitate water drainage. Think about installing a French drainpipe or sump pump in areas prone to flooding.
In addition, be positive in keeping an eye on humidity degrees inside your home. Using dehumidifiers in wet areas, such as basements and creep rooms, can substantially reduce the threat of mold development and structural damages.
Last but not least, purchase high quality products and technologies, such as water leak detection systems, which can inform you to concerns before they escalate. By carrying out these preventative actions, homeowners can considerably lower the chance of future water damage, protecting their building and preserving its value. Regular assessments and a dedication to upkeep will certainly give tranquility of mind and protection against unforeseen water-related catastrophes.
